Daphne cneorum Variegata Details

Daphne cneorum variegata is a small, spreading shrub grown for its fragrant, rose-pink flowers in spring. This plant produces masses of flowers that literally transforms its appearance. They are held above the small leaves that are variegated green and cream. It grows compactly to about 40 cm tall and 60 cm wide, growing best in full sun or partial shade on a well-drained site. It is hardy to cold environments and frosts once established. Daphne cneorum variegata is commonly included in rock and cottage gardens, maintained in a container, or planted close to a window or door so the fragrance can fill the house.
